Previous municipality experience related to transportation is desirable DISTINGUISHING CHARACTERISTICS Senior Engineer, P.E
is the advanced professional level class in the professional engineering class series. Incumbents are responsible for managing assigned land development or capital improvement projects and performing the most complex professional engineering work requiring a substantial level of professional training and experience. Incumbents are also responsible for supervising, assigning, monitoring and overseeing the work of assigned professional, technical and administrative support staff.
Assignments are of a continuing nature, requiring the exercise of independent judgment, initiative and problem-solving. Senior Engineer, P.E. is distinguished from Associate Engineer in that incumbents in the former class are expected to perform the most complex professional engineering work, requiring professional registration and a greater degree of engineering experience
THE TRANSPORTATION DIVISION The Transportation Engineering Division assesses neighborhood and regional traffic concerns and implements corrective measures to enhance vehicle, bicycle, and pedestrian safety. The staff works closely with the Western Riverside Council of Governments (WRCOG), the Riverside County Transportation Commission (RCTC), the California Department of Transportation (CALTRANS), and adjoining agencies to insure consistency and uniformity with regional transportation programs. Our staff operates and maintains 201 traffic signals and 418 centerline miles of roadway signing and striping.
